Post the auction id so we can take a look at it.
Its not a bad choice the budget end of the market. The most important thing for your records is to have a well chosen and set up cartridge in good condition with the right tracking weight, bias and geometry. I think I may have tweaked one of these in the past, or a very similar model, but to a degree it does depend how skilled you are. (I didn't go to town on that particular turntable, as the owner was fairly non-critical, and a bit lazy and it was for occasional use, so IMO keeping the automatic functions was a good idea) /sreten. |
